Mousse à la Banana
This creamy dessert is low in saturated fat, cholesterol, and sodium.
|
2 Tbsp milk, low-fat (1%) |
- Place milk, sugar, vanilla, and banana in blender. Process 15 seconds at high speed until smooth.
- Pour mixture into a small bowl; fold in yogurt. Chill. Spoon into four dessert dishes; garnish each with two banana slices just before serving.
|
Yield: 4 servings Serving size: ½ cup Each serving provides: Calories: 94 Total fat: 1 g Saturated fat: 1 g |
Cholesterol: 4 mg Sodium: 47 mg Fiber: 1 g Protein: 1 g Carbohydrate: 18 g Potassium: 297 mg |
